Description
A group of soldiers from A Company, 4th Battalion, The Royal Australian Regiment (4RAR) at the 4RAR Rest and Convalescence (R&C)
Centre at Old Bau, which was also where the battalion headquarters and the reserve rifle company were also based. The soldiers are enjoying a "Coke", probably at the Blue Lake cafe. Left to right: unidentified, an identified Iban tracker, Private (Pte) John Burns, Pte Bruno Adamczyk; the names of the other soldiers are not known. A Company 4RAR were based at Gumbang between April and September 1966. This was the most southerly of the 4RAR company positions and was located on a ridge line close to the Sarawak-Kalimantan border and a major Indonesian infiltration route.
